Celery
Fresh, grassy, watery, lightly bitter, and savory when cooked.
Lens analyzedCelery is a crisp aromatic vegetable used raw for crunch and cooked as a base flavor in soups, stews, stocks, and sauces.
Where it comes from
Celery moved from medicinal and herb uses into everyday cooking as milder cultivated stalks became common in markets.
Varieties — Pascal celery is common; celery hearts are tender; leaves are useful as herbs.
It is a named allergen in some regions and can matter for sensitive households.
In a modern kitchen — Use leaves in stocks or salads instead of throwing them away.
Buying it
Choose firm bunches with crisp ribs, fresh leaves, and no limp or brown wet spots.
Storing it
Refrigerate wrapped or in a produce bag; keep whole until needed for best crunch.
Keeps about 14 days in the fridge.
In season
Peak season is July–October, though it's available year-round.
Local celery is most common from midsummer into fall; shipped supply keeps it available year-round.
Out of celery? Good swaps
- Fennel — Use the bulb chopped for similar crunch and a base aromatic; adds a gentle anise note.
- Bok choy stems — Use the crisp stalks for crunch and mild flavor in soups and stir-fries.
- Green bell pepper — Use in a mirepoix-style base for vegetal flavor and body when celery is missing.
